Businesses are slowly becoming more receptive to offering gluten-free menu options, including many that are quite tasty.

So, here is a list of restaurants and available gluten-free food in the immediate harbor area of Boothbay Harbor:

McSeagull’s Restaurant

http://mcseagullsonline.com/menu/web.pdf

Haddock or chicken Francaise dishes are battered with gluten-free flour. The restaurant’s pizza also can be made with a gluten-free crust.

Ports of Italy

http://portsofitaly.com/boothbay/

As advertised on the website, everything on the menu can be made gluten-free.

Mama D’s Café Mercantile

https://www.mamadscafe.net/

Gluten-free options prepared in a non-gluten-free setting. Notable foods are omelettes and gluten-free crustless veggie pie.

Bridge Street Café

http://bridgestreetcafebbh.com/

Homemade gluten-free breads available as well as gluten-free New England clam chowder.

Regional locations for gluten-free food

Smugglers Cove Inn Restaurant

727 Ocean Point Road

East Boothbay

Prepared by a gluten-free chef, Smuggler’s Cove can make just about everything on its menu gluten-free. Some notable foods are sandwich breads, pasta, English muffins (gluten-free eggs Benedict), clam chowder, haddock and homemade hummus.
